Personal Facts, Age, Height and Biography of Alex Trebek

Alex Trebek, born on July 22, 1940, was a celebrated television presenter and a prominent figure in the world of game shows. He became a household name as the host of the iconic quiz show Jeopardy!, a role he held for an impressive thirty-seven seasons from its revival in 1984 until his passing in 2020. Trebek's charm and intellect made him a beloved pop culture icon, and his contributions to television extended beyond Jeopardy! to include hosting various other game shows such as The Wizard of Odds, Double Dare, and Classic Concentration.

A native of Canada, Trebek embraced his American identity after becoming a naturalized citizen in 1998. His work on Jeopardy! earned him numerous accolades, including eight Daytime Emmy Awards for Outstanding Game Show Host, a testament to his exceptional talent and dedication to the craft. Trebek's influence on the television landscape was profound, and he made memorable appearances in films and television series, often portraying himself.

Tragically, Trebek's life was cut short when he succumbed to stage IV pancreatic cancer in November 2020 at the age of eighty. At the time of his death, he was under contract to continue hosting Jeopardy! until 2022, highlighting his unwavering commitment to the show and its fans.
